WebbShare The Dalai Lamas are believed by Tibetan Buddhists to be manifestations of Avalokiteshvara or Chenrezig, the Bodhisattva of Compassion and the patron saint of Tibet. Bodhisattvas are realized beings, inspired by the wish to attain complete enlightenment, who have vowed to be reborn in the world to help all living beings. WebbAtiśa Dīpaṃkara Śrījñāna (982–1054), known as Jowo Jé Palden Atisha (jo bo rje dpal ldan a ti sha) in Tibetan, was a great Indian master and scholar.He spent the last ten years of his life in Tibet, teaching and translating texts, and was instrumental in reinvigorating Buddhism there after a period of persecution and decline.
